UNIVERSITY PARK, Pa. - David M. Callejo Pérez, chancellor and dean of Penn State Harrisburg, has been appointed interim regional chancellor for Penn State Hazleton, Penn State Scranton and Penn State Wilkes-Barre, effective April 1.
Callejo Pérez will serve in this role while continuing as chancellor and dean of Penn State Harrisburg and while a national search for a permanent regional chancellor continues and is well underway.
"I look forward to working with David in this role and am grateful that his experience with our campuses will support a smooth transition as we complete the search," said Renata Engel, vice president for Commonwealth Campuses and executive chancellor.
Callejo Pérez joined Penn State in 2019 as associate vice president and senior associate dean for academic programs for the Commonwealth Campuses and later served as interim vice president for Commonwealth Campuses. He was appointed chancellor and dean of Penn State Harrisburg in 2024.
Durell Johnson, who has served as interim regional chancellor for the northeast campuses since fall 2025, will return to his position as campus chief academic officer at Penn State Scranton.
"We are thankful to Durell for his leadership and commitment to our northeast campuses during a period of transition," said Engel. "He has supported faculty, strengthened academic leadership, and worked closely with community partners while maintaining a focus on both immediate needs and the long-term future."
